A lower omega-6 to omega-3 fatty acid ratio (specifically 4:1 or lower) reduces total mortality and cardiovascular disease risk compared to the standard Western ratio of 15:1-16.7:1.
To improve heart health and reduce inflammation, shift your diet to lower the ratio of omega-6 to omega-3 fats. Aim for a ratio of 4:1 or lower. This means eating more fatty fish (salmon, mackerel) or taking fish oil supplements, while reducing intake of oils high in omega-6 like corn, soybean, and sunflower oils. Replace these with olive oil or canola oil, which have a more favorable profile. This shift helps reduce inflammation and cardiovascular risk.
Excessive amounts of omega-6 polyunsaturated fatty acids (PUFA) and a very high omega-6/omega-3 ratio, as is found in today’s Western diets, promote the pathogenesis of many diseases, including cardiovascular disease, cancer, and inflammatory and autoimmune diseases, whereas increased levels of omega-3 PUFA (a lower omega-6/omega-3 ratio), exert suppressive effects.
Why this rating
The paper is a review citing multiple clinical trials (Lyon Heart Study, GISSI) and observational data, though it lacks a single large-scale RCT establishing a universal optimal ratio.

- A lower omega-6 to omega-3 ratio (specifically 2.5:1) reduces rectal cell proliferation in patients with colorectal cancer, whereas a higher ratio (4:1) with the same omega-3 amount has no effect.Moderate
- A lower omega-6 to omega-3 ratio (2-3:1) suppresses inflammation in patients with rheumatoid arthritis, and a ratio of 5:1 has a beneficial effect on asthma, whereas a ratio of 10:1 has adverse consequences.Moderate
